ICCON is now Align

For years the Intentional Churches Conference has been built on one conviction: Great Commission breakthroughs happen when the right leaders get in the right room.

ICCON laid the foundation. ALIGN is the next chapter, and the name says what actually moves a church forward. Not one inspired leader. A whole team pointed in the same direction.

Same mission. Same rooms. A sharper focus on turning vision into a plan your team can run the week you get home.
